* xrender.lisp: Define the 'render-op type. Needed if type checking is enabled.
Regards Douglas Crosher
Index: Experimental/freetype/xrender.lisp =================================================================== RCS file: /project/mcclim/cvsroot/mcclim/Experimental/freetype/xrender.lisp,v retrieving revision 1.2 diff -u -r1.2 xrender.lisp --- Experimental/freetype/xrender.lisp 2 Dec 2004 09:11:41 -0000 1.2 +++ Experimental/freetype/xrender.lisp 16 Mar 2006 04:56:58 -0000 @@ -353,6 +353,10 @@ :out :out-reverse :atop :atop-reverse :xor :add :saturate :maximum))) )
+(deftype render-op () + '(member :clear :src :dst :over :over-reverse :in :in-reverse + :out :out-reverse :atop :atop-reverse :xor :add :saturate :maximum)) + ;; Now these pictures objects are like graphics contexts. I was about ;; to introduce a synchronous mode, realizing that the RENDER protocol ;; provides no provision to actually query a picture object's values.